Output 68516a8efd7e30883e5587346d4dfe087495b23f3dc398c77c6f976f9adbe6bd:0

value
1839000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e59685a52d9c04c2145002ca7842c83fe06acf98 OP_EQUAL
address
3NcxyvoTKkij4SmhDNpxvAqWLuei1AUieq
transaction
68516a8efd7e30883e5587346d4dfe087495b23f3dc398c77c6f976f9adbe6bd
spent
true